You realize that the entire zombie genre, when done well, is ALWAYS about character development, not the zombies, right? It's ABOUT relationships and how different archetypes cope with the situation, how they change, how they interact, how they get along, or don't, what stays the same, what influences their decisions, who lives and how or why, what do you compromise, how do you persevere, when do you give up, what do you leave the next generation? It's about which character do you most empathize with, what would you do differently, how honest are you with yourself? Christ, zombies are barely even IN the original Night of the Living Dead, because it's ABOUT something.

(Point of FACT: There are actually no zombies in Night of the Living Dead at all.)

The word "zombie" is never uttered a single time in the original Night of the Living Dead. They are referred to as "ghouls", or, "...all messed up". Go go gadget trivia. I think the IMDB thing is written for a new crowd. I believe they were ghouls in the original cast list as well.

EDIT: Oh yeah, check it out. Wikipedia lists them as ghouls as well. http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Night_of_the_Living_Dead

#211 10 years ago

Yes, in the comic characters have referred to "zombies", but they remark how silly it sounds to be talking about them as real creatures, hence the monikers.

I'm not setting this up as a pissing match dude, it's just a minor bit of movie history trivia. The term "zombie" movie was sort of misapplied to Night of the Living Dead due to other conventions. It was a ghoul movie. As a progenitor of a genre we look back now, and say, oh, check it out, the first zombie movie. Frankenstein by modern definitions is a science fiction story, but Shelly would never have called it that despite being credited as the modern genre's first author.
